2017-02-05 11 views
1

Я прочитал это Google doc. В нем говорится, что мы не используем продукт в списке.Список продуктов в Schema.org

Итак, для списка продуктов (категория похожих продуктов с многостраничными типами «обувь»), какую схему рекомендуется использовать?

Я использую это:

<script type="application/ld+json"> 
{ 
    "@context": "http://schema.org", 
    "@type": "WebPage","name": "page name", 
    "url": "http://www.example.com/shoes" 
    "mainEntity":{ 
     "@type": "ItemList", 
     "itemListElement":[{ 
      "@type": "BlogPosting"... 
      }] 
    } 
    . 
    . 
    . 

Но BlogPosting для продуктов, кажется, это неправильно.

+0

Зачем делать * вы используете 'BlogPosting'? И почему бы не «Продукт»? – unor

+0

@unor из-за этого в документе: «Используйте разметку для определенного продукта, а не категорию или список продуктов». – Maral

ответ

0

Связанная документация для Google Products rich result. В нем говорится, что этот конкретный богатый результат не поддерживает списки с разными продуктами. Но это не должно мешать вам отмечать такие списки.

Это даже против Google’s guidelinesне размечать каждый продукт в списке:

страницы категории листинг несколько различных продуктов (или рецептов, видео или любой другой типа). Каждый объект должен быть помечен с использованием соответствующего типа schema.org, такого как schema.org/Product для страниц категории продуктов. Маркировка только одного субъекта категории из всех перечисленных на странице противоречит нашим рекомендациям.

Ваш пример JSON-LD является подходящим способом выделения списка продуктов (заменяющих BlogPosting с Product, конечно). Но вместо WebPage вы можете использовать CollectionPage.